VICE GOV PELAEZ ORGANIZES AHMPO IN TALISAYAN

-

Deriving inspiratio­n from a prayerful community, VICE GOVERNOR JOEY G. PELAEZ, together with PROVINCIAL BOARD MEMBER JIGJAG G. PELAEZ who was represente­d by his daughter JELIZZA M. PELAEZ, organized the A Happy MisOr People’s Organizati­on or AHMPO in Talisayan, Misasmis Oriental on Saturday, 16 June 2018. The event saw the active participat­ion of representa­tives from various sectors in the municipali­ty.

AHMPO, which sounds like “ampo” which means prayer in Bisaya, hopes to inspire a transforma­tion of values and character among Misamisnon­s; empower individual­s and communitie­s towards growth and developmen­t; and build A Happy MisOr communitie­s, among others.

According to Vice Governor Pelaez, AHMPO will touch base with individual­s and communitie­s, look after the poor and the underserve­d, and help them grow out of poverty through programs, projects and advocacies. Thus, sustaining the gains of the A Happy MisOr efforts and fostering individual and community growth.

Award-winning actress ASSUNTA DE ROSSI, newly-crowned Mr. Universe Tourism ION PEREZ, Ms. Philippine Youth NADINE BORNILLA and Mr. Philippine Youth ALMAHIL BIH II, Former Quezon Board Member and President of KASAMA Incorporat­ed GERALD ORTIZ came and declared their support to AHMPO and the various initiative­s of Vice Governor Pelaez. It was witnessed by the youth, Boy Scouts, teachers and school administra­tors, young profession­als, women, elderly, Barangay officials, ordinary people and other sectors.

In the same occasion, Vice Governor Pelaez turned-over a cash assistance worth 49,900 pesos for the Women of Wisdom, which was received by its President ROSALINA JANIO.

The launch was supported by Talisayan VICE MAYOR JOSEFINA OMONDANG, Municipal Administra­tor MARIANO CANDANO, Talisayan National High School Principal AILEEN DABON, Santa Ines Elementary School Principal JUSTINIANO ABUEVA, Babanlagan Elementary School Principal CARMELITO TALIPAN, Barangay Chairperso­ns JOSEPH IPOC, CHONA MOPAR, and BOYET ENTERINA, and Talisayan Women’s Federation President ROSALINA JANIO.
